Tag: Mermaid
Posted in Uncategorized
Mermaid Royale Slot (80 Free Spins!) No Deposit Bonus!
Author: Stephen Gonzalez Published Date: February 16, 2023
Mermaid Royale Slot (80 Free Spins!) No Deposit Bonus! => Play on Mermaid Royale Slot Now! Unleash the power of the ocean and swim to…
Recent Comments